Ingredients:
- 4 skinless boneless chicken thighs
- 200g fresh pineapple chunks
- 1 small shallot
- Juice of 1 lime, plus extra wedges for serving
- Small handful fresh coriander, roughly chopped
- 1 ripe avocado, cubed
- 8 small corn or flour tortillas
- 2 tbsp chipotle paste
- 2 tbsp runny honey
- 1 1/2 tsp tomato puree
- 1 tsp salt
- 2 large garlic cloves
Marinating the Chicken
Step 1: Prepare the Marinade and Chicken
To get started on these fantastic One Pan Chicken & Pineapple Tacos, we need to create a flavorful marinade for our chicken. First, let’s mince the two large garlic cloves. You can use a garlic press for a super fine mince, or simply finely chop them with a knife. Next, in a medium-sized bowl, combine the minced garlic with the 2 tablespoons of chipotle paste, 2 tablespoons of runny honey, and 1 1/2 teaspoons of tomato puree. Stir these ingredients together until they form a relatively smooth paste. Now, it’s time to prepare the chicken. Pat the 4 skinless boneless chicken thighs dry with paper towels. This step is important as it helps the marinade adhere better to the chicken and promotes better searing later on. Once dried, place the chicken thighs directly into the bowl with the marinade. Use your hands or a spoon to ensure each piece of chicken is thoroughly coated in the delicious chipotle-honey mixture.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and let it marinate in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. For even deeper flavor, you can marinate it for up to 2 hours. While the chicken is marinating, we can get a head start on prepping the other components.
Step 2: Prepare the Pineapple and Shallot
While the chicken is soaking up all that amazing flavor, let’s focus on the pineapple and shallot. You should have about 200g of fresh pineapple chunks. If your chunks are too large, feel free to cut them into bite-sized pieces, roughly similar in size to your chicken pieces once they’re cut. This will ensure they cook evenly alongside the chicken. Next, we need to finely dice the small shallot. Shallots have a milder, sweeter flavor than regular onions, which will complement the other ingredients beautifully without overpowering them. Aim for a fine dice so that the shallot softens and melds into the dish rather than remaining in large, distinct pieces. Set these prepared pineapple chunks and diced shallot aside. You’ll also want to juice one lime and have extra wedges ready for serving. Lastly, roughly chop your small handful of fresh coriander and cube your ripe avocado. Having all your ingredients prepped and ready to go, often referred to as “mise en place,” makes the cooking process much smoother and more enjoyable.
Cooking the Tacos
Step 3: Sear the Chicken and Sauté Aromatics
Now that our chicken has marinated and our other ingredients are prepped, it’s time to bring everything together in one pan. Heat a large oven-safe skillet or cast-iron pan over medium-high heat. Once the pan is hot, add a tablespoon of neutral oil (like vegetable or canola oil) if your pan isn’t non-stick. Carefully place the marinated chicken thighs into the hot skillet in a single layer. You want to hear a good sizzle as the chicken hits the pan; this indicates a good sear. Let the chicken cook undisturbed for about 3-4 minutes per side, until nicely browned and seared. Don’t overcrowd the pan; if necessary, cook the chicken in batches to ensure proper searing. Once the chicken is seared on both sides, remove it from the pan and set it aside on a plate. In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ium. Add the diced shallots to the pan and sauté for about 2 minutes until they begin extract to soften and become fragrant.
Step 4: Incorporate Pineapple and Finish Cooking
After the shallots have softened, add the prepared pineapple chunks to the skillet. Stir them around for another 2-3 minutes, allowing them to pick up some of the delicious browned bits from the bottom of the pan and start to caramelize slightly. Now, it’s time to bring the chicken back into the fold. Return the seared chicken thighs to the skillet, nestling them among the pineapple and shallots. Pour the juice of the 1 lime over the chicken and pineapple. Season everything generously with 1 teaspoon of salt. Stir everything gently to combine and ensure the chicken is mostly submerged in the juices. Cover the skillet with a lid or aluminum foil and let it simmer gently for about 10-15 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and tender. You can check for doneness by cutting into the thickest part of a chicken thigh; the juices should run clear, and the meat should be opaque throughout. The pineapple will soften and release its sweet juices, creating a wonderful sauce.
Step 5: Warm the Tortillas and Assemble
While the chicken and pineapple are finishing their simmer, it’s the perfect time to warm your 8 small corn or flour tortillas. You can do this in a separate dry skillet over medium heat for about 30 seconds per side until they are pliable, or wrap them in a damp paper towel and microwave them for about 30-45 seconds. Once the chicken is cooked, remove the lid from the skillet. You can choose to shred the chicken directly in the pan using two forks, or remove the chicken and shred it on a cutting board before returning it to the pan. Stir the shredded chicken and pineapple mixture together, ensuring it’s all coated in the flavorful pan juices. Now, for the assembly! Lay out your warm tortillas. Spoon a generous portion of the chicken and pineapple mixture onto each tortilla. Top with the cubed ripe avocado and the roughly chopped fresh coriander. Serve immediately with extra lime wedges on the side for squeezing over your delicious One Pan Chicken & Pineapple Tacos. Enjoy the vibrant flavors and satisfying textures!

Frequently Asked Questions about One Pan Chicken & Pineapple Tacos:
Q: Can I use a different type of protein instead of chicken?
A: Absolutely! While chicken is fantastic, this recipe works wonderfully with beef tenderloin cut into bite-sized pieces or even firm tofu for a vegetarian option. Adjust the cooking time accordingly for the protein you choose.
Q: What are some other good serving suggestions for these tacos?
A: Beyond the classic taco fixings, consider serving your One Pan Chicken & Pineapple Tacos with a side of creamy avocado salsa, a refreshing corn salad, or even some seasoned rice. They also make a great filling for quesadillas!
